Meaning
Angle of attack sensors are devices used in the aviation industry to measure the angle between the aircraft’s reference line and the oncoming airflow. This angle, known as the angle of attack, is a critical parameter that affects the aircraft’s lift, drag, and stall characteristics. Angle of attack sensors use various sensing technologies, such as differential pressure, strain gauges, or optical methods, to accurately measure the angle of attack and provide the necessary information to the flight crew and control systems. These sensors are essential for safe and efficient flight operations.

Category-wise Insights
- Differential Pressure Sensors: Differential pressure sensors are widely used angle of attack measurement devices that rely on the pressure difference between two sensor ports to determine the angle of attack.
- Strain Gauge Sensors: Strain gauge sensors utilize strain-sensitive elements to measure the deformation caused by the airflow on the aircraft surface, providing accurate angle of attack data.
- Optical Sensors: Optical sensors use light reflection or refraction principles to measure the angle of attack, offering advantages such as non-intrusiveness and high accuracy.
